Description
Easy Shepherd’s Pie Casserole is a hearty, comforting dish featuring savory ground beef and vegetables topped with creamy mashed potatoes, perfect for family dinners.
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up frozen mixed vegetables (peas, carrots, corn)
- 2 tablespoons tomato paste
- 1 cup beef broth
- 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 3 cups mashed potatoes (prepared from about 3 large potatoes)
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a skillet, cook ground beef with chopped onion and garlic until beef is browned; drain excess fat.
- Add frozen mixed vegetables, tomato paste, beef broth,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per. Simmer for 5–7 minutes.
- Transfer beef mixture to a greased 9×13-inch baking dish.
- Spread mashed potatoes evenly over the beef mixture and dot with butter.
- Optional: s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top.
- Bake uncovered for 20–25 minutes, until the top is golden and bubbly.
Notes
- Use leftover mashed potatoes to save time.
- Optional: add a layer of gravy or cream sauce for extra richness.
- Leftovers store well in the fridge for 3 days and reheat easily.
